Home foundation repair services involve assessing and fixing issues that affect the stability and safety of a building’s foundation. These services typically include inspecting the foundation for signs of damage, such as cracks, uneven floors, or sticking doors, and then implementing repairs to restore structural integrity. Common methods used by service providers may include underpinning, piering, or stabilization techniques designed to reinforce the foundation and prevent further deterioration. The goal is to ensure the home remains safe, level, and secure for years to come.
Many foundation problems stem from shifting soil, moisture changes, poor construction, or age-related wear. These issues can lead to cracks in walls and floors, doors and windows that no longer close properly, or even more serious structural concerns. Addressing these problems early with professional foundation repair can help prevent costly damages to the entire property. Service providers work to identify the root causes of foundation issues and apply targeted solutions that restore stability and prevent future movement.

The overview below groups typical Home Foundation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Pella, IA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or foundation repairs, such as small cracks or localized settling, gener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, with fewer projects reaching higher costs. Local contractors usually handle these repairs efficiently within this budget.
Moderate Repairs - More extensive issues like larger cracks or partial foundation stabilization tend to cost between $1,000 and $3,500. Projects in this range are common for homeowners experiencing noticeable shifts or damage. The final cost can vary based on the severity and scope of work needed.
Major Repairs - Significant foundation problems, including extensive cracking or structural reinforcement, can range from $4,000 to $8,000. Many of these projects involve complex solutions, with fewer jobs exceeding this higher tier. Local service providers can assess and provide detailed estimates for such repairs.
Full Foundation Replacement - Complete foundation replacement or major underpinning work often exceeds $10,000 and can reach $20,000+ for larger, more complex projects. These are less common and typically involve extensive planning and resources, with local contractors providing customized estimates based on the specific situation.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s that a home foundation needs repair? Indicators include visible cracks in walls or floors, uneven or sloping floors, doors and windows that stick or don’t close properly, and gaps around window frames or doorways.
How can local contractors assess foundation issues? They typically perform a visual inspection, check for structural movement, and may use specialized tools to evaluate soil stability and foundation settling.
What types of foundation repair services are available? Services can include underpinning, pier and beam repairs, slab stabilization, and crack injections to restore stability and prevent further damage.
Are foundation repairs necessary for minor cracks? While small cracks may be superficial, a professional assessment is recommended to determine if they indicate underlying issues that require repair.
